Chemical Property Profile of Uracil, 3,6-dimethyl-5-(morpholinomethyl)-1-phenyl-, monohydrochloride
Property Insights of Uracil, 3,6-dimethyl-5-(morpholinomethyl)-1-phenyl-, monohydrochloride
The XLogP value of 1.09862 suggests moderate lipophilicity, balancing water solubility and membrane permeability for Uracil, 3,6-dimethyl-5-(morpholinomethyl)-1-phenyl-, monohydrochloride. With a topological polar surface area (TPSA) of 56.47 Ų, Uracil, 3,6-dimethyl-5-(morpholinomethyl)-1-phenyl-, monohydrochloride ex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, Uracil, 3,6-dimethyl-5-(morpholinomethyl)-1-phenyl-, monohydrochloride has 0 hydrogen bond donor(s) and 4 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
